International Relations Office

The International Relations Office is responsible for administering and supporting international matters at Bern University of Applied Sciences (BUAS). It organises the University’s participation in international education and research programmes, supports the departments in implementing internationalisation and takes care of foreign guests and students. In particular, the International Relations Office is available to help deal with issues that are not confined to one specific area or department.

The Bern University of Applied Sciences (BUAS) International Relations Office is always glad to help foreign universities, international partners, teachers and other staff (incoming and outgoing) with information on international co-ordination, internationalisation in teaching and research, and mobility at BUAS.

 

For matters concerning a specific division or department, get in touch directly with the specialist  within the department concerned.
